About the Origin Sarajevo

Sarajevo is the capital city of the Bosnia and Herzegovina. It is one amongst historical cities in Europe and considered as the largest city in the country with an estimated population of 430,000. The city is popular as it is a diverse land with different religions and traditions. Islam, Catholicism, Orthodoxy, and Judaism are coexisting in the city from centuries. The city is the center for Eastern & Western Roman Empire split and has Roman Catholics on west, Orthodox in east, and Ottoman to the south. It is the place, where ‘Archduke Franz Ferdinand’ was assassinated, which leads directly to the First World War. During 1992-95, the city was severely battered by the Yugoslavia and lost most of its cultural and architectural marvels. However, in recent years, it is recuperating with cosmopolitan environment and acclaimed as one of the rapidly growing city and safest, liveable city in South Eastern Europe.

Shopping Dining & Nightlife

The city is a home for carpets and grand malls in the nation. While visiting the city, tourists can experience the traditional shopping at Baščaršija (Bedesten). This is a covered market place with plentiful shops and this was built by Ottomans during 15th century. Sarajevo City Center, BBI Center, Alta Shopping Center, Bosmal City Center, Importanne Center, Mercator Sarajevo, Grand Centar Ilidža, and Mercator Dobrinja are the prime shopping malls with numerous stores. Visitors can find wide range of shopping collection in these modern malls. Bosnian food varieties are unique and deliciously luring. Cevapi is the most available food in the nation and in its capital, Sarajevo. Whilst there are pita, Balkan kebab, Burek, and many more local delights ubiquitously available in the city. Along with the local cuisines, restaurants will offer plentiful varieties of other continental delights. Domestic beers are the choice of most of the locals and visitors. Distinct brands of beers will be served in bars and taverns along with delicious local snacks. Rakija, (a Bosnian alcohol beverage) comes in different tastes and will be available all over the city.

Weather in Sarajevo

Sarajevo enjoys humid continental climate with hot summers and chilly snowy winters. During summer the climate will be quite warm with an average daily high temperature above 23°C. August is the hottest month of the year. The city is an excellent spot for winter with an average daily temperature below 8°C, which lasts from November through February. Early fall and late spring are good seasons to enjoy the weather in Sarajevo; they have mild temperatures and pleasant climate. Pretty rainfall will be received in the evenings throughout the year. All the seasons are preferred time to visit Sarajevo, depending on your individual concerns.

About Sarajevo Airport & Location

Sarajevo International Airport (IATA: SJJ, ICAO: LQSA) is the primary gate to Bosnia and Herzegovina, located suburb of Butmir for about 6 kilometers southwest of the city Sarajevo. The airport has nonstop flights for around seventeen cities and it is hub for flagship carrier ‘BH Airlines’. Nearly 210 domestic and international flights depart through this airport each week and have direct flights to many cities in Europe and United States.

Airport Terminal Information

The city airport has a single terminal with two level building, which can accommodate around 8 million passengers per year, twelve check-in counters, five passenger gates, and spacious central hall. The terminal is fully equipped with all passenger amenities.

Local Transportation at Sarajevo Airport

Sarajevo International Airport can be reached only by taxis; there is no public transportation available to and from the airport.
